Bottega Veneta The Pouch Leather Clutch

The era of the Dior saddle has quieted and made way for the era of the Bottega anything. Daniel Lee’s creations for the house have been instantly adopted as top trends in luxury circles, with last season’s Cassette bag subsumed by this season’s Pouch.

Simon Miller Puffin Bag

This pillow-like pouch from New York-based Simon Miller has found itself not only a hot design this season, but a useful one too. The extra long strap can be extended and shortened to extremes so that it's easy to carry over the shoulder and in-hand, depending on what your day is shaped like.

Telfar Small Shopping Bag

Nearly impossible to get one’s hands on, this affordable cult bag from Brooklyn-based designer Telfar Clemens is not only celebrity-worthy, it’s the zeitgeist’s hallmark of a true trend-setter. Clemens is a Black designer whose brand has been nominated for a CFDA award and been shown in museums. The bags are critically elusive, but if you pay close attention, you can sometimes buy one, say, through a food-ordering app alongside hot sauce, as with one of Clemens’s signature campaigns.
